Lesson Description

In the upper room on the same night Jesus was betrayed and arrested, Jesus and His disciples shared the Passover meal together—and Jesus gave it new meaning. Taking unleavened bread, He stated it represented His body, given for His followers. Taking the cup, He said it was His blood shed for His followers.

Clearly the Passover foreshadowed Jesus sacrifice for sinners on the cross. This particular Passover meal became the Last Supper and the first Lord’s Supper. When we observe the Lord’s Supper today, we look back to Jesus’ sacrifice and remember Him with gratitude, we thank God for the present reality of salvation, and we look to the future return of our Lord. Preschoolers won’t understand all of this, but they can learn about the Last Supper and that it was a very important event in God’s unfolding story.
